Comparison: Firestone Winterhawk 3 vs. Bridgestone Blizzak LM-005

In this comparison, we are comparing a tyre from a manufacturer from USA (Firestone) against a tyre from a manufacturer from Japan (Bridgestone). Generally, Bridgestone winter tyres are slightly better rated (87%) than Firestone (56%). The first tyre test of Firestone Winterhawk 3 was done in 2015, compared to 2019 when was the Bridgestone Blizzak LM-005 first tested. Important for this comparison is also the Autobild 2020 245/45 R18 test, where both the Winterhawk 3 and the Blizzak LM-005 were tested. See more mutual tests below. When it comes to comparison, eu labels can be also interesting - 92% of Firestone Winterhawk 3 has C wet grip rating, whereas 95% of Bridgestone Blizzak LM-005 has A rating.
